&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Vaikunth Dattaram Kuncolienkar&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(25 August 1925 – 9 February 2003), known professionally as &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;K. Vaikunth&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, was an Indian cinematographer who worked primarily in Hindi films between 1956 and 1990. He worked with well-known directors like [[Hrishikesh Mukherjee]], [[Ramesh Sippy]], [[Gulzar]], [[Manmohan Desai]], [[Ramanand Sagar]], and [[Ravindra Dave]].&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
He served as a cinematographer on several popular and critically acclaimed movies. These include &am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Mere Sanam]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(1965), [[Raaz_(1967_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Raaz&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]] (1967), [[Bandhan_(1969_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Bandhan&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]] (1969), [[Andaz_(1971_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Andaz&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1971), [[Parichay_(film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Parichay&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1972), &am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Seeta Aur Geeta]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039;  (1972), [[Achanak_(1973_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Achanak&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]] (1973),&lt;br /&gt;
[[Roti_(1974_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Roti&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]] (1974), &am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Aandhi]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039;  (1975), [[Khushboo_(1975_film)|&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Khushboo&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1975), [[Mausam_(1975_film)|&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Mausam&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1975), and [[Meera_(1979_film)|&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Meera&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1979).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
[[Bandhan_(1969_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Bandhan&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]]  (1969), [[Andaz_(1971_film)| &amp;#039;&amp;#039;Andaz&amp;#039;&amp;#039;]], and &am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Seeta Aur Geeta]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(1972) had successful runs in theaters for a significant period.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= When a Goan cinematographer stole the show| author=Govind Kamat |url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/when-a-goan-cinematographer-stole-the-show/articleshow/55643638.cms|publisher=Times of India| date = 27 November 2016}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Vaikunth also worked with leading documentary film makers such as [[Paul Zils]], S. Sukhdev, and Rajbhans Khanna.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= When a Goan cinematographer stole the show| author=Govind Kamat |url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/when-a-goan-cinematographer-stole-the-show/articleshow/55643638.cms|publisher=Times of India| date = 27 November 2016}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Forgotten face of hills| author=Brinda Sarkar |url=https://www.telegraphindia.com/west-bengal/forgotten-face-of-hills/cid/396504|publisher=Telegraph India | date = 3 August 2012}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Celebrated by film legends, winner of Prez medal, Iffi fails to recognise Margao&amp;#039;s ace lensman|url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/celebrated-by-film-legends-winner-of-prez-medal-iffi-fails-to-recognise-margaos-ace-lensman/articleshow/115063030.cms|publisher=Times of India | date = 8 November 2024}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Goa&amp;#039;s technical legacy to the Indian film industry|author=Patricia Ann Alvares |url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/goas-technical-legacy-to-the-indian-film-industry/articleshow/61711031.cms|publisher=Times of India  | date = 19 November 2017}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In a career spanning more than five decades, Vaikunth worked on more than 35 feature films, apart from ads and documentaries.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= K Vaikunth|url=https://kvaikunth.com/about/|date = 7 October 2025}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Many film heroines of the time have credited Vaikunth for making them look as beautiful as possible on screen.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Hema Malini, the only heroine who ever commanded the box office is 75|author=Subhash K Jha  |url=https://www.iwmbuzz.com/movies/news-movies/hema-malini-the-only-heroine-who-ever-commanded-the-boxofficeis-75/2023/10/16|publisher=Iwmbuzz  | date = 16 October 2023}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

==Early life and career==&lt;br /&gt;
K Vaikunth was born Vaikunth Dattaram Kuncolienkar in Margao on 25 August 1925. In the late 1940s, he assisted cinematographer Surendra Pai on &am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Bari Behen]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(1949) and Pandurang Naik. During this time, he adopted the simpler screen name K Vaikunth.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= K Vaikunth|url=https://kvaikunth.com/about/|date = 7 October 2025}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Tribute to cinematographer K Vaikunth with &amp;#039;Aandhi&amp;#039; screening in Panaji|url=https://www.thegoan.net/goa-inshorts/tribute-to-cinematographer-k-vaikunth-with-%E2%80%98aandhi%E2%80%99-screening-in-panaji/136421.html|publisher=The Goan Everyday| date = 20 September 2024}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&amp;#039;&amp;#039;[[Garam Coat]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039; (1956), directed by Amar Kumar, was Vaikunth&amp;#039;s first feature film as a cinematographer. His first documentary was &amp;#039;&amp;#039;The Story of Kashmir&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, produced and directed by Rajbhans Khanna.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Celebrated by film legends, winner of Prez medal, Iffi fails to recognise Margao&amp;#039;s ace lensman|url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/celebrated-by-film-legends-winner-of-prez-medal-iffi-fails-to-recognise-margaos-ace-lensman/articleshow/115063030.cms|publisher=Times of India | date = 8 November 2024}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

The documentary &amp;#039;&amp;#039;And Miles to Go&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, produced by S. Sukhdev and shot by Vaikunth, won the [[National Film Award for Best Non-Feature Film]] in 1964. It also won the Bengal Tiger Award at the third [[International Film Festival of India]] (IFFI) in 1965. The documentaries &amp;#039;&amp;#039;The Story of Kashmir&amp;#039;&amp;#039; and &amp;#039;&amp;#039;The Great Betrayal&amp;#039;&amp;#039; won the President&amp;#039;s Medal and other international awards.&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Goa&amp;#039;s technical legacy to the Indian film industry|author=Patricia Ann Alvares |url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/goas-technical-legacy-to-the-indian-film-industry/articleshow/61711031.cms|publisher=Times of India  | date = 19 November 2017}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ite AV media|title = And Miles To Go|url=https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=gcFSP6MrQxI|publisher=Films Division  | date = 7 October 2025}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{Cite news|title = Celebrated by film legends, winner of Prez medal, Iffi fails to recognise Margao&amp;#039;s ace lensman|url=https://timesofindia.indiatimes.com/city/goa/celebrated-by-film-legends-winner-of-prez-medal-iffi-fails-to-recognise-margaos-ace-lensman/articleshow/115063030.cms|publisher=Times of India | date = 8 November 2024}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
